Amino Acid Sequence
Cyclo(Gly-Phe-Ile-Gly-Trp-Gly-Asn-β-Asp)-Ile-Phe-Gly-His-Tyr-Ser-Gly-Asp-Phe
Biochem/physiol Actions
Competitive antagonist at atrial natriuretic peptide NPR-A receptors.
Other Notes
A cyclic peptide
